Transaction 803353a0ab429e3e23a7866858b625dd093478168f0eb9377ce48b5155a8f1a3
1 Input
1 Output
-
803353a0ab429e3e23a7866858b625dd093478168f0eb9377ce48b5155a8f1a3:0
- value
- 1809904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cdd43be05b94bb7b14386734453a6508b462568 OP_EQUAL
- address
- 3EXqb8o6ZShy84Zy1xcq7pMQDkUmWeunC6